Calculate the value of P and of Q that satisfy the following simultaneous linear equations.
[tex] \frac{1}{2} p - 3q = 11 \\ 5p + 6q = 2[/tex]

  1. 0.5p -3q =11
  2. 5p +6q =2

1) ×-2

--> 3. -p +6q =-22

2) - 3)

6p =24

p =4

sub into 2)

5(4) +6q =2

20 +6q =2

6q =2 -20 =-18

q=-3
